Runner’s World teamed up with Men’s Health to bring you four new workouts, all about improving core stability.
A strong core is essential for great running performance, and that’s why all runners should incorporate core workouts into their training, according to research. In fact, asays doing so can improve energy transfer, motor control, and the force you put into your steps, which leads to performance gainsThat core work goes beyond just targeting your abs, too. To create stability and boost efficiency on the run, you need to work other muscles of the core, including the glutes, back, and hip flexors.
While you’ll experience a bounty of benefits by regularly doing core workouts, you don’t need to dedicate a ton of time to it.
